What to Check Before Registration

A credible casino should present important information in a way that is easy to locate. Look for licensing details, responsible gambling tools, privacy policies, and clearly written bonus conditions. Registration should not feel rushed, particularly if the platform requests personal documents for verification.

  • Confirm that the operator displays relevant licensing and regulatory information.
  • Read the privacy policy before submitting identity or payment details.
  • Check whether two-factor authentication or other account security features are available.
  • Review minimum deposits, withdrawal limits, and processing times.
  • Make sure the service is legally available in your location.

Verification is a normal part of regulated online gambling. It may involve proof of identity, address, or payment ownership. Completing the process early can reduce delays when requesting a withdrawal later.

Understanding Return to Player

Return to player, commonly called RTP, is a statistical estimate calculated over a very large number of rounds. It is not a promise that a particular session will return a set percentage. Short-term results can vary considerably, especially on games with high volatility. Comparing RTP figures can add useful context, but it should never replace a personal spending limit.

Bonuses, Wagering Rules, and Real Value

Promotions can provide extra playing funds, yet the headline amount rarely tells the entire story. A welcome offer may include a wagering requirement, a maximum stake while the bonus is active, restricted games, an expiry date, and a maximum convertible win. Each condition affects the practical value of the promotion.

Before opting in, identify whether the casino applies a game contribution percentage. For example, slots may contribute fully toward wagering, while some table games contribute only partially or may be excluded entirely. Also check whether cash funds are used before bonus funds and whether a withdrawal cancels an active offer.

  • Record the bonus expiry date immediately after activation.
  • Check the permitted stake per spin or hand.
  • Compare wagering requirements with the deposit and bonus amount.
  • Look for maximum win and withdrawal restrictions.
  • Decline promotions that do not match your planned budget.

Deposits, Withdrawals, and Account Support

Payment convenience matters, but security and transparency matter more. Available methods may include bank cards, bank transfers, electronic wallets, or other region-specific services. Deposits are often instant, whereas withdrawals can take longer because of internal checks and payment-provider processing.

Use a payment method registered in your own name and keep confirmation emails or transaction references. If a withdrawal is delayed, contact support with the relevant details rather than opening multiple requests. A useful support team should explain the reason for a delay, identify missing documents, and provide a realistic timeframe.

Building a Sensible Playing Routine

Responsible gambling begins before the first wager. Decide how much money and time you can afford to spend, then treat those limits as fixed. Deposit limits, session reminders, cooling-off periods, and self-exclusion tools can reinforce that plan. Avoid increasing stakes to recover losses, and never use essential household funds for gambling.

A simple routine can improve control: choose a maximum session budget, set an end time, avoid playing while distracted or distressed, and review your activity regularly. If gambling stops feeling entertaining or begins affecting finances, relationships, sleep, or work, pause immediately and seek support from an appropriate local service.
